Kirkbymoorside is a popular market town situated at the foot of the North York Moors National Park. It lies along the A170 Thirsk to Scarborough road providing quick and easy access to the neighbouring market towns of Helmsley and Pickering, Scarborough on the east coast and Malton to the south where there are good road and rail links to the City of York. Within the town is a doctors surgery, library, chemist, Spar and Co-op amongst other every day amenities and also an 18 hole golf course.
Ings Lane is located to the South of the town and is but a five minute walk to the shops. No.36 is an end terrace of three with an Easterly aspect. It has been extended over the time that the current owner has had the property to offer an extra reception room and an extra bedroom/hobby room above. The accommodation comprises a fitted kitchen to the front of the house, a down stairs cloakroom and a good sized living room with patio doors that open into the rear garden. From the living room a door opens into the extension which has been used as a snug; having a log burning stove. A closed staircase rises from the living room to two double bedrooms with a wet room located in-between them. The bedroom to the rear of the house, mirroring the room below has a doorway that opens into another room that could be used as another bedroom or as with the current owner a useful hobby room and study. The gardens enclose the whole property and are mostly down to low maintenance gravel, however there is an area of cultivated soil where vegetables have been grown. The garden also houses a useful timber framed workshop, a green house and a covered veranda.
